Ingredients for Baked Carrots, Turnips, and Rutabagas Recipe

2 lg Carrots; quartered (I sliced
-them.)
1 md Turnip; quartered
1 md Rutabaga; quartered
1/4 c Dry sherry or veggie broth;
-(I used the broth.)
1 tb Apple juice concentrate
1 tb Honey or brown sugar
1 ts Grated lemon rind

Baked Carrots, Turnips, and Rutabagas Preparation

Hi, all. I’m catching up on back digests and saw a recent interest in rutabagas. I found a great recipe in the January/97 issue of Vegetarian Times (page 49). Note: Roots get sweeter when they’re cooked slowly. Preheat oven to 350. PAM a 2 qt. casserole dish (if necessary). Arrange veggies in dish. In small bowl combine sherry or broth, apple juice concentrate, honey or brown sugar, and lemon rind. Drizzle over root veggies. Cover with aluminum foil and bake till tender, about 40-50 minutes.
